// send a NDEF message to adnroid or get a NDEF message
//
// note: [NDEF library](https://github.com/Don/NDEF) is needed.
#include "SPI.h"
#include "PN532_SPI.h"
#include "snep.h"
#include "NdefMessage.h"
PN532_SPI pn532spi(SPI, 10);
SNEP nfc(pn532spi);
uint8_t ndefBuf[128];
void setup()
{
Serial.begin(115200);
Serial.println("-------Peer to Peer--------");
}
void loop()
{
#if 1
Serial.println("Send a message to Android");
NdefMessage message = NdefMessage();
message.addUriRecord("http://www.seeedstudio.com");
int messageSize = message.getEncodedSize();
if (messageSize > sizeof(ndefBuf)) {
Serial.println("ndefBuf is too small");
while (1) {
}
}
message.encode(ndefBuf);
if (0 >= nfc.write(ndefBuf, messageSize)) {
Serial.println("Failed");
} else {
Serial.println("Success");
}
delay(3000);
#else
Serial.println("Get a message from Android");
int msgSize = nfc.read(ndefBuf, sizeof(ndefBuf));
if (msgSize > 0) {
NdefMessage msg = NdefMessage(ndefBuf, msgSize);
msg.print();
Serial.println("\nSuccess");
} else {
Serial.println("failed");
}
delay(3000);
#endif
}
